ABOUT BRYSON CITY. . .
Bryson
City ranks 3rd in the State for Recycling per Capita!
Bryson
City is on the Tuckasegee River
The
community was named for Capt. Thaddeus Bryson, one of the founders
of Charleston
Population
is approximately 1400
Local landmarks include a monument to Tsali, a Cherokee warrior
executed in 1838 for resisting the removal of his people from the
southern Appalachians

Alcohol
Policies. . .
Restaurants
The town of Bryson City permits the sale of alcoholic beverages
within the city limits; and a number of Bryson City restaurants
offer beer, wine and mixed drinks.
Outside
of the city limits, only certain qualifying Swain County resorts are permitted to serve alcohol by the drink. Also, some
restaurants have "brown bag" permits allowing patrons
to bring their own alcoholic beverages. (Containers must be kept
out of plain view).
Because
of differing policies, restaurant patrons are advised to check with
the restaurant ahead of time.
Bottle
Sales
In Bryson City, liquors are sold at the ABC Store on Veterans Boulevard
(9 to 9, Monday through Saturday).
Beer
and wine is sold only at grocery stores, convenience store and package
stores within the city limits. Hours vary from store to store, but
may be from 6 am to midnight, except on Sunday, when sales are only
permitted from noon to 6 pm. [TOP] |
